What is the origin of Bhosale family?

The Bhonsle (or Bhonsale, Bhosale, Bhosle) are a prominent group within the Maratha clan system. They claim descent from the Sisodia Rajputs but were likely Kunbi tiller-plainsmen.

Who founded the Bhosale family?

Raghuji Bhonsle of Berar founded the dynasty in 1730. There were eight rulers in the line. They ruled at Nagpur in present-day Maharashtra state and were a leading power in the 18th-century Maratha confederacy.

Who is the grandfather of Shivaji Maharaj?

Maloji, the grandfather of Shivaji married the sister of Jagpal Rao Nail Nimbalkar the ‘deshmukh’ of Phultun. Maloji’s son Shahji joined the count of Bijapur and was married to Jijiyabai. Shahji and Jijiyabai’s youngest son was Shivaji. He was born at Shivaneri on April 10, 1627.

What are the literary sources of Shivaji Maharaj?

The literary source, Shivaji’s biography or Bakhar written by Sabhasad in 1694 which was elaborated by Chitragupta. Sambhaji’s Adanapatra or Marathishahitil Rajaniti of Ramachandra Pant Amatya written in 1716 is another important source.
